Portfolio Analyst applicants have rated the interview process at Wellington Management with 3.3 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 33% positive. To compare, the company-average is 65.6%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Portfolio Analyst roles take an average of 13 days to get hired, when considering 3 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Wellington Management overall takes an average of 28 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Wellington Management as a Portfolio Analyst according to 3 Glassdoor interviews include:
One on one interview: 33%
Background check: 17%
Phone interview: 17%
Personality test: 17%
Skills test: 17%
